| 3.1 | Aroma | Appearance | Flavor | Palate | Overall | | 7/10 | 3/5 | 6/10 | 2/5 | 13/20 | Jun 5, 2005 Brought this one back from Brazil to try, glad to see I’m the first! Pale, hazy yellow, decent head. Aroma of lemons, wheat, and faint clove spice. Lemon is predominant. Slightly thin mouthfeel, flavor matches the aroma. As it warms, the lemon notes fade into the background, replaced by an indisctinct clove spice. There is also the faint suggestion of adjuncts with the malt, which would explain the thin body. Overall though, this is a decent beer, particularly by Brazil standards. ghawener (983), San Salvador, El Salvador

| 3.6 | Aroma | Appearance | Flavor | Palate | Overall | | 8/10 | 4/5 | 7/10 | 3/5 | 14/20 | Nov 6, 2005 550ml bottle. Rather hazy straw-colored yellow with long-lasting thin white head. Massive aroma of lemon citrus, musty yeast, banana, clove and bread. Flavor much the same though not as intense, dominated by citrus and clove with some musty yeast. Medium palate. A fine hefe from Brazil?? Believe it -- this stuff is better than some popular German versions.
